What skills and experience we're looking for
South Nottinghamshire Academy have a fantastic opportunity for a Catering Assistant to join their dedicated team. The successful candidate will be required to provide an efficient and friendly canteen service to all students and staff.
Experience of working with young people, in the catering industry and a knowledge of health and safety requirements would be advantageous.

Commitment to safeguarding
Our organisation is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children, young people and vulnerable adults. We expect all staff, volunteers and trustees to share this commitment. Our recruitment process follows the keeping children safe in education guidance. Offers of employment may be subject to the following checks (where relevant): childcare disqualification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S) medical online and social media prohibition from teaching right to work satisfactory references suitability to work with children You must tell us about any unspent conviction, cautions, reprimands or warnings under the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act 1974 (Exceptions) Order 1975.
